If you stick with stock headers & replace the primary cats with high flow cats, catback exhaust, will it throw a code? Just wondering if the HFCs will throw a code. Sorry to hijack the thread.
|
09-25-2021, 07:27 PM | #11 |
Drives: 2014 Camaro 2SS Join Date: Feb 2015
Location: Metro Detroit
Posts: 492
|
If it throws anything, it will be a catalysts efficiency code.
|
09-25-2021, 07:41 PM | #12 |
Drives: 2012 Camaro SS Join Date: Aug 2021
Location: Central Florida
Posts: 19
|
So, is that what usually happens? I'm asking because I have a catback I'd like to install and if I should change the primaries to high flow when I install it, I'd rather do it all at the same time.
|
09-25-2021, 07:53 PM | #13 |
Drives: 2012 Camaro SS Join Date: Dec 2019
Location: New York
Posts: 1,434
|
High flow cats will throw a code. Plus to have rear o2 sensors installed you have to weld in bunds into the exhaust. Gotta tune out the rear o2’s after high flow cat install.
